Neuroplasticity and Psilocybin: Redefining Mental Health Treatments Beyond Traditional Therapies

In recent years, the exploration of alternative **mental health treatments** has taken center stage as traditional approaches alone often fall short for many individuals. One of the most promising areas of research and application is the use of **psilocybin**—a naturally occurring **psychedelic compound** found in certain mushroom species. Notably, the impact of psilocybin on **neuroplasticity** offers new horizons in mental health care.

Neuroplasticity refers to the brain’s ability to reorganize itself by forming new **neural connections** throughout life. This adaptability is crucial for learning, memory, and recovery from **brain injuries**. Psychedelics, particularly psilocybin, have shown promise in enhancing neuroplasticity, hence potentially redefining mental health treatment paradigms. A key facet of interest is how psilocybin could complement or even surpass conventional therapies, particularly in assuaging disorders related to **depression**, **anxiety**, and **PTSD**.

For decades, the use of psilocybin and other psychedelics was relegated to the fringes of scientific inquiry due to legal and moral stigmatization. However, the resurgence of psychedelic research in the early 21st century, driven by more lenient legal frameworks and a burgeoning mental health crisis, has shed light on its therapeutic potential. In facilitated environments, psilocybin-assisted therapy has produced positive outcomes by promoting profound, insightful experiences that foster new cognitive patterns and perspectives.

Current **clinical trials**, such as those led by institutions like **Johns Hopkins University** and **Imperial College London**, indicate that psilocybin can instigate a more open and interconnected mindset long after its immediate effects dissipate. This phenomenon is attributed to psilocybin’s impact on **serotonin receptors** in the brain, promoting a more adaptable neural network—a stark contrast to the rigid patterns often observed in individuals suffering from mental health disorders.

Moreover, neuroplasticity induced by psilocybin is believed to create a fertile ground for **cognitive flexibility**, **creativity**, and **emotional resilience**. Unlike traditional antidepressants or anxiolytics, which sometimes suppress emotional ranges or merely mask symptoms, psilocybin invites users to confront and reframe their problems. This active engagement with one’s psyche can lead to long-lasting changes in behavior and mental health, reducing reliance on medications while offering a more holistic treatment strategy.

Significant studies have begun to unravel the potential mechanisms behind psilocybin’s impact on the brain. A prominent study published in *Nature* found that psilocybin increased dendritic spine density and size, which are integral to the synaptic connections involved in neuroplasticity. This structural enrichment suggests a biologically plausible explanation for the enduring emotional and cognitive benefits reported by patients post-therapy. Furthermore, a two-year follow-up study conducted by the Center for Psychedelic and Consciousness Research at **Johns Hopkins University** revealed that psilocybin assisted therapy produced substantial and sustained decreases in depression severity, as detailed in a report in *JAMA Psychiatry*. [JAMA Study](https://jamanetwork.com/journals/jamapsychiatry/fullarticle/2772630) These findings highlight not only the immediate impact of psilocybin sessions but also their potential to induce long-term positive changes in thought patterns and emotional regulation.

Legal frameworks are evolving, with jurisdictions like **Oregon** decriminalizing psilocybin for medical use, following robust clinical evidence supporting its safety and efficacy under professional guidance. As regulatory bodies catch up with scientific advances, rigorous studies are required to refine dose-dependent safety profiles and therapy protocols.
